I took the Utah non resident ccw class from CCUSA on Friday in lawrenceburg. I have to say I was very pleased with the entire process. The instructor made it painless and kept the class flowing even while doing pictures, fingerprints, and paperwork. I thought it very reasonable at $100 dollars for the Utah license and they were offering the Arizona license for an additional $10.
The price included the class, paperwork,fingerprints and photo copies of drivers license and Indiana license to carry.
Any one that is looking for a non-resident permit to gain more states to legally carry in I suggest these guys.
